Our genes are the blueprint and plan of our body, controlling many traits, such as eye color, height, and talent. Unfortunately, our genes are not spared errors, and each of us carries certain genetic defects and genetic variations that have a detrimental impact on our health.
Such genetic variations can increase the risk of diabetes, thrombosis, or cancer; they can determine how effectively we eliminate toxins from the body; they are responsible for intolerance to certain food components, such as gluten and lactose, or how susceptible we are to developing periodontal disease.
Genes determine which medications are effective and which lead to serious side effects. Similarly, genes determine whether our immune system will reject a titanium dental implant.

Genetic variations determine how your body reacts to certain nutrients and food components, and which of them can be processed and properly utilized.
Diet plays a key role in the development of many diseases, and now we can analyze your genes and adapt your diet to neutralize your genetic risks, thanks to the latest technologies.
If genetic analysis determines that you have a high risk of developing osteoporosis, it is advisable to change your diet and increase calcium intake by consuming calcium-rich dairy products. However, if you are simultaneously predisposed to lactose intolerance, your diet should include other calcium-rich foods, such as broccoli.

In about 80% of cases, obesity is caused by genetic variations. Some of us, due to our unfavorable genes, may gain weight because we absorb too much fat from food, while others may have twice the amount of fat in their diet and absorb only the minimum necessary amount. The situation is identical with carbohydrates; while some gain weight because they consume carbohydrates, others are completely spared regardless of the amount of sugar they ingest. The required level of physical activity and calorie reduction to lose weight also depends on genes. How is it done?
If you and your physician decide to use this analytical package, a sample will be taken from the oral cavity using a cotton-tipped swab. When the sample arrives at the laboratory, your DNA is extracted, and the relevant genetic segments are examined for variations. Our scientists will determine your genetic profile and create a customized prevention and treatment program.
